Why These Are the Top BMW Repair Auto Repair Shops in Clitherall

** The BMW repair market serving Clitherall, Minnesota, is characterized by a reliance on high-quality independent shops located in surrounding regional hubs like Detroit Lakes, Fergus Falls, and Alexandria. There are no dealerships or BMW-exclusive specialists within Clitherall itself. The competition level is moderate, with a handful of reputable shops vying for the European car owner demographic. The average quality of service is notably high, as these independent shops survive by offering dealership-level expertise with more personalized service and lower labor rates. Typical pricing is competitive for specialized work, generally ranging from $120-$150 per hour for labor, which is significantly less than a BMW dealership. For context, a standard oil service on a late-model BMW may cost $150-$250, while complex engine or xDrive system diagnostics and repair can easily run into the $1,500-$4,000+ range, depending on the issue. Customers in this region are advised to book appointments well in advance, as the best shops often have waiting lists due to their specialized skill sets.

How do Minnesota winters and rural roads around Clitherall affect my BMW?

The harsh winter climate, road salt, and gravel roads common in Otter Tail County can accelerate wear on BMW components like suspension parts, brakes, and undercarriage. It's crucial to maintain the all-wheel-drive system (xDrive) and to implement thorough seasonal tire changes and undercarriage washes to prevent corrosion and ensure safe handling.

What are the most common BMW repair issues for drivers in this area?

Beyond universal BMW concerns like electronic system faults and oil leaks from gaskets, local driving conditions make suspension components (control arms, bushings), brake systems, and cooling system integrity frequent repair items. These are stressed by temperature extremes and variable road surfaces encountered on routes through lakes country.

Should I expect higher repair costs for my BMW in this region compared to cities?

Labor rates may be slightly lower than in major metro areas, but the specialized nature of BMW repairs and the potential need to source specific parts can keep costs significant. Building a relationship with a trusted local shop can help manage expenses, and factoring in travel to a specialist is part of the total cost consideration.
